The British Isles

Off the North west coast of the continent of Europe there is an archipelago known as The British Isles. This a geographic description rather than a political description. There are two large islands and over 1000 small islands.

The largest island is called Great Britain and it contains England, Wales and Scotland.

The other large island is called Ireland and it contains The Republic of Ireland and Northern Ireland.

Political divisions

The island of Great Britain, plus Northern Ireland and some of the small islands make up The United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land (abbreviated 'UK').

The remaining larger part of the island of Ireland is the aforementioned Republic of Ireland.

Additionally there are the 3 "Crown Dependencies." of the Isle of Man, Jersey and Guernsey. These are semi-independent, they have internal self-government but international relations are the responsibility of the UK government. Jersey and Guernsey are usually not considered part of the British Isles as they are nearer to the French coast.
